Abstract

This Decree-Law establishes wines production with appellation of origin «Porto» and «Douro». It consists of 16 articles and 1 annex regulating 'Porto' and 'Douro' wines production, establishing standards, restrictions and requirements to be satisfied in order to be classified with the aforementioned appellation of origin and placed on the market. It includes geographical limits of this area.
